When traited, a fire trap’s cooldown is 12 seconds. I’m not sure what your definition of a high cooldown is for a utility skill, but as far as ranger utilities are concerned, traps are on the lower end.
Fire trap is the one with the lowest cooldown…yes, and it still doesn’t make it any good dps wise compared to a power/crit build. It lasts 3 seconds, 12 seconds cooldown…there it goes 9 seconds of DPS waste for the most part as you won’t always be hitting from the sides or behind mobs in a dungeon so condition builds are not really optimal for that.
The reason i said their cooldown is “too high” is because you can’t spam traps and to be honest only fire trap makes “decent” damage. I’d prefer to run berseker set up and use slow traps to support the party instead, it makes it easier to “kite” certain packs of mobs or perma slow down champions, and for that you don’t need condition damage.
